Egg Costs, World Gates, and Base Click Multipliers
Every pet in the game is a multiplier stacked on top of your base clicks, and the only way to unlock new ones is by hatching eggs with the Clicks you earn from tapping. Each egg costs a different amount of Clicks, opens on a different world, and pulls from a different rarity pool. Pets of the same rarity share an Egg Multiplier (the % added to your clicks per pet), which is why duplicating a Rare is usually better than holding a single Legendary you never equip.
The pet system has three layers:
-
Hatching layer: pay Clicks, open an egg, get a random pet from a fixed pool
-
Equipping layer: pick up to eight active pets to multiply your total clicks-per-second
-
Trading layer: swap duplicates for pets you are missing, which is where the secret pet value conversation starts to matter
Rarity bands matter because they determine both the Egg Multiplier range and whether a pet is locked behind a specific world, event, or admin code. Most players start by burning every Click on the first egg they can afford, then slowly unlock the better pools as they Rebirth and push into World 2 and Tech World. The Full Clicker Simulator Pet List by Rarity
The current clicker simulator all pets catalog is grouped into six bands, and each band has its own Egg Multiplier ceiling. Drop rates below are sourced from community testing and the in-game egg preview tooltip; treat them as ballpark figures because the developer has rebalanced numbers in nearly every patch since the June 2026 launch.
Basic, Rare, and Epic Pets
| Rarity | Example Pets | Egg Multiplier | Egg Source | Approx. Drop Rate |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Basic | Cat, Dog, Bunny | 1.10x – 1.50x | World 1 Starter Egg | ~60% of all hatches |
| Rare | Turtle, Penguin, Koala | 1.75x – 2.50x | Forest Egg, Ice Egg | ~25% of all hatches |
| Epic | Wolf, Dragon, Phoenix | 3.00x – 5.00x | Volcanic Egg, Tech Egg | ~10% of all hatches |
Basic pets are the floor of the clicker simulator pet list and exist mostly to fill your active slots in the first hour of play. They are not worth trading for and should be auto-sold once you unlock a Rare drop, because the Egg Multiplier gap is enormous. Wolf and Phoenix are the standout Epics because their 5x ceiling is the highest in the band, and they stay relevant into mid-World 2 even after you start seeing Legendaries.
Legendary Pets
| Pet | Egg Source | Egg Multiplier |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| Griffin | Volcanic Egg | 7.5x | World 2 unlock, solid first Legendary |
| Hydra | Tech Egg | 9.0x | Best pre-Mythic multiplier |
| Unicorn | Event Egg | 8.0x | Limited-time pool |
| Yeti | Ice Egg | 6.5x | Pairs well with snow-themed buffs |
Legendary is where the clicker simulator all pets pool starts to feel rewarding. Drop rates sit around 4% per egg, so expect to crack roughly 25 eggs before you see one. The Hydra from the Tech Egg is the early chase pet because its 9x multiplier is the highest pre-Mythic ceiling in the game, and it has been a community favorite since the September 10, 2026 update added a small bonus to Tech World pets.
Mythic Pets
| Pet | Egg Source | Egg Multiplier | Drop Rate |
|---|---|---|---|
| Phoenix Eternal | Mythic Egg | 15x | ~1% |
| Cosmic Cat | Mythic Egg | 18x | ~0.7% |
| Shadow Dragon | Shadow Egg | 20x | ~0.5% |
| Time Lord | Tech Egg (rare branch) | 22x | ~0.3% |
Mythics are the visible ceiling for most players, and they are also the floor of the clicker simulator best pets conversation. The Time Lord from the Tech Egg branch has the highest raw multiplier in the band, but the Shadow Dragon is the easier chase because the Shadow Egg is cheaper to spam. Community data suggests an average of 200 Mythic Egg hatches before a single Mythic drops, so budget your Clicks accordingly.
Secret Pet Quests, Admin Codes, and the Eight Confirmed Drops
The clicker simulator secret pets tier sits above Mythic and is gated by hidden quests, admin codes, or extremely rare egg branches. The clicker simulator all secret pets pool currently includes eight confirmed entries, and the developer teases a ninth roughly once per major patch. Most secret pets are not in any standard egg pool; you either earn them through a specific in-game action or trade for them.
Confirmed Secret Pets
| Secret Pet | Unlock Method | Approx. Value (community-reported) |
|---|---|---|
| Pixel Cat | Type /code pixelcat in chat during a live event | High |
| Glitched Dog | Open 1,000 eggs of any kind in one session | High |
| Rainbow Unicorn | Trade five Legendaries to the NPC in Hub World | Very High |
| Astral Phoenix | Beat the World 3 final boss in under 3 minutes | Very High |
| Cookie Monster | Join the Cooked Click Roblox group and claim the group reward | Medium |
| Quantum Wolf | Hidden puzzle in Tech World sub-level 4 | Very High |
| Crystal Turtle | Limited Christmas event (currently unavailable) | High |
| Void Bunny | Random drop from the Void Egg (1 in 50,000) | Extreme |
The clicker simulator best pets list almost always includes at least one secret, because their multipliers routinely clear 25x and the supply is fixed. The Void Bunny is the rarest entry in the entire clicker simulator pet list because it is the only secret that drops from a standard egg, and community testing places it at roughly 1 in 50,000. If you are hunting rather than trading, focus on the Astral Phoenix and Quantum Wolf, because both are skill-gated and bypass the lottery-style RNG of the others.

How to Decide Which Pets to Keep, Sell, or Trade
The clicker simulator best pets question is not actually about rarity alone — it is about active slot efficiency. You can only equip eight pets at a time, so duplicating a high-multiplier Epic will often out-trade a single Legendary you never equip.
Decision Framework by Account Stage
| Account Stage | Keep | Sell | Trade For |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pre-Rebirth 1 | All Basics, all Rares, all Epics | Duplicates only | Nothing yet |
| Rebirth 1 – 5 | Top 3 Epics, all Legendaries | Basic/Rare duplicates | Mythics |
| Rebirth 6 – 10 | Best Mythics, any secret | All Basics and Rares | Dark Matter Dragon |
| Rebirth 10+ | All Dark Matter, all secrets | All Epics and below | Specific Mythic branches |
The general rule: never sell a pet that unlocks a hidden quest, never trade a Mythic for an Epic, and never auto-sell a secret even if you do not use it. Secrets hold their value because the supply is fixed, while a duplicate Epic loses 80% of its trade value within a week of a new patch.
Egg Spending Strategy and Drop Rate Math
Hatching eggs without a plan is the single biggest mistake new players make, because the clicker simulator all pets pool is large enough that bad egg choices will stall your progression. A simple Clicks-to-Multiplier ratio helps you decide which egg to spam at each stage.
| Egg | Cost (Clicks) | Best Rarity Ceiling | Best Clicks-to-Multiplier Ratio |
|---|---|---|---|
| Starter Egg | 100 | Epic | Poor (until you have 8 pets equipped) |
| Forest Egg | 1,000 | Legendary | Medium |
| Volcanic Egg | 5,000 | Legendary | Strong |
| Ice Egg | 5,000 | Legendary | Medium |
| Tech Egg | 10,000 | Mythic | Best (after Rebirth 3) |
| Mythic Egg | 50,000 | Mythic | Best at Rebirth 6+ |
| Shadow Egg | 25,000 | Mythic | Strong for budget hunters |
| Void Egg | 100,000 | Secret (Void Bunny) | Lottery only |
The Tech Egg is the long-term best value once you hit Rebirth 3, because it can drop both the Hydra Legendary and the Time Lord Mythic. Until then, spam the cheapest egg that can still drop your current target rarity, because every Click spent on a higher-tier egg is a Click you did not spend on upgrades.
